メモリの位置を表示
プログラム変数の生の内容を調べるために、メモリ位置を表示します。
手順
- デバッグ領域で、表示したいメモリの変数を Control - クリックします。
- ショートカットメニューから"変数" の[メモリ表示(View Memory)] を選択してください。
- 表示されたメモリ位置の中から選択するために、デバッグナビゲーターを使用してください。
デバッグ領域から新しいメモリ位置を表示すると、エントリがデバッグナビゲーターに追加され、選択されます。選択されたメモリエントリの内容は、エディタペイン内のメモリブラウザに表示されます。
メモリブラウザの下部には、メモリをナビゲートし、その表示をカスタマイズするために使用するコントロールが含まれています。
- アドレス。 メモリブラウザに表示されるメモリの先頭アドレスを指定します。
- メモリページ。 メモリページを前後に移動します。
- バイト数。 メモリ・ページのバイト数を指定します。
- バイトのグループ化。 表示されたメモリブロックのサイズを指定します。
メモリ位置は、アプリケーションが現在のデバッグセッションで実行されている間だけ有効です。アプリケーションを終了すると、Xcode はデバッグナビゲーターからすべてのメモリエントリを削除し、それらを破棄します。まだデバッグ中のメモリのエントリを削除するには、エントリを選択し、Delete キーを押します。
関連記事
デバッグ領域について
デバッグナビゲーターについて